Who uses Mumsnet?
Mumsnet is a global online network but most of our users are UK-based. Not everyone who uses Mumsnet is a parent or grandparent, but initially most people come to the site seeking parenting advice - and then stick around discussing a wealth of topics from childcare to chicken keeping, and nurseries to news.

I'm not a Mum - can still I join Mumsnet?
We hope Mumsnet isn't exclusive to mums and indeed we know we have a number of dads who log on and contribute. If it doesn't sound too pompous we think the concept of "mumming/mothering" goes beyond gender so don't feel Mumsnet is too exclusive. We did think of calling the site parentsnet.com but it just sounded so hideous. We do have Dadsnet specifically for men to chat here but you'll find that if you just contribute on the regular threads folks won't be surprised by having a male joining in. Similarly, we have a section specially for grandparents, Gransnet.

How do I post a message on Talk?

  • At the bottom of each conversation (or "thread") on talk there is an "add a message" box.
  • Type your message in and fill in your nickname and your password.
  • When you have finished your message click the "Preview/Post message" button.
  • Your screen redraws showing how your message will look. This gives you a chance to check your message is typed correctly.
  • If you want to make changes, make them and click the "Preview/Post message" again to refresh your preview.
  • Once you are happy with your message, click "Post message".
  • It then goes up on the site and other members can see it.

How do I advertise my small business on Mumsnet?
You can place paid advertisements on the Mumsnet Talk board here. Advertisers pay a fee of £50 per ad as a contribution to the site. Ads and any responses to them will be deleted after 90 days. This fee is payable by credit card via WorldPay, our payment agent, who will email you a receipt.
